Linux TBOOT:安全启动新纪元
linux tboot

首页 2024-12-22 09:29:25



探索Linux下的TBOOT:重塑系统安全的基石 在当今的数字化时代,信息安全已成为不容忽视的重大议题

    随着黑客攻击手段的不断进化与复杂化,传统的安全防护措施已难以满足日益增长的安全需求

    在这样的背景下,一种名为TBOOT(Trusted Boot)的技术应运而生,为Linux系统乃至整个计算环境的安全防护提供了新的思路与解决方案

    本文将深入探讨TBOOT技术的原理、优势以及在Linux环境下的应用,旨在揭示其如何成为重塑系统安全基石的重要力量

     一、TBOOT技术概览 TBOOT,全称Trusted Boot,是一种基于硬件虚拟化技术的安全启动方案

    它利用了Intel和AMD处理器中的TXT(Trusted Execution Technology)和SVM(Secure Virtual Machine)等特性,旨在确保从系统启动之初就处于一个可信的环境中,从而有效防止恶意软件在系统启动前或启动时潜入

     TBOOT的工作流程大致如下: 1.初始化阶段:在系统加电后,BIOS(基本输入输出系统)首先加载并执行

    TBOOT作为BIOS与操作系统之间的一层,会在BIOS完成自检后接管控制权

     2.验证阶段:TBOOT利用TXT或SVM技术创建一个隔离的、受保护的环境,称为“可信执行环境”

    在这个环境中,TBOOT会对操作系统内核、引导加载程序等关键组件进行完整性验证,确保它们未被篡改

     3.加载阶段:一旦验证通过,TBOOT才会允许这些组件继续执行,从而确保操作系统在一个干净、可信的状态下启动

     这一机制从根

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道